Codon是什么意思_翻译中文_怎么读

codon

美式发音: ['koʊdɒn] 英式发音: ['kəʊdɒn]

n.【生】(遗传)密码子

网络释义:码字;代码子;编码子

复数:codons  

网络释义

n.1.【生】(遗传)密码子

n.1.a unit in messenger RNA consisting of a set of three consecutive nucleotides that specifies a particular amino acid in protein synthesis
